    We were looking for somewhere to eat in the Spring area and we decided to check this restaurant out. The parking is free and the restaurant is nice. They have a patio area but it was too cold to eat outside. We came at a great time because we were seated immediately, without a reservation, and then it got crowded. The host was good and explained today's special to us before our waiter came. We started with the Chips & Queso with ground beef and it was AMAZING and had a nice kick to it! I had the Shrimp and Grits and added crawfish to it. It was too bland for my liking even after adding salt and pepper. My husband had the fish and chips and it was good. For dessert, we had the bread pudding and it was good. We tried two cocktails each and they were all great! Our waiter, Ben, was amazing, and the manager stopped by to see how everything went. Overall, it was a good experience.

    Who's the Bosscat? You, if you got Rosalie D as your waitress. She was awesome. The decor really…read moregot the old whiskey bar flair. DJ was spinning tunes inside but we opted for outdoor seating on their covered patio as it was a nice day. I gotta say I had some trepidation given our CM's earlier experiences here. But everything turned out just fine on our visit. First off I love that everything on the menu is under $20. That means we can order more. I was a bit worried that out steak and eggs would be tough because I ordered it medium rare and it came out more medium well. It's even cut already so they should've been able to tell how well done it was. But it was still tender which is actually all I really cared about. The Holy Smoked Benedict is not your traditional eggs Benedict. Instead of ham they have slices of pork belly. And it's served on a crispy biscuit (I could taste the crunch) with potatoes with a poached egg on top just like a regular Benedict. My only comment would be a little too many potatoes for my particular liking, but you can just brush them off. With the money we saved we got the beignets. They come in a sack of 5 and with a Meyer lemon curd on top side for dipping that has a dollop of melted marshmallow cream on top. They aren't traditional beignets but are really small biscuits. They tasted hot and fresh, and were nice and fluffy regardless, which again is all I really cared about. Cold water comes in an old whisky bottle and is left at your table so you can pour as much as you want when you want. I really wish more restaurants did this.
